Background
Cities have started raising sky creepers in ongoing decades for various reasons, remembering the scarcity of space for swarmed cities, the chance to procure much from the upward construction by leasing or selling space, or to demonstrate the strength of a country's economy. Tokyo's population growth from the previous 100 years till the present has considerably outperformed that of other congested metropolises like New York City or London, and the shortage of space in the Tokyo metropolitan locale appears to be developing, prompting a significant issue with traffic, expensive leases, and so on. Because of this, Japanese engineers thought of the splendid idea of growing massively upward as opposed to continuing on developing on a level plane. Building the 1000-meter-tall Tokyo Sky City 1000 was the idea put out in 1989, and it stayed the world's highest structure right up 'til now (Al-Kodmany, 2018). In excess of 100,000 individuals would reside in the tall, vertical metropolis, which would also be home to the first sky homesteaders ever. Sky City 1000 is an ambitious mix of residential housing, business office space, and a tourist destination that is poised to become one of the world's highest structures. The 1,000-meter-tall Takenaka Construction Co., Ltd. tower is wanted to have 14 aeronautical bases, or Space Plateaus, layered on top of each other to make a design masterpiece. Each space plateau will be designed to oblige business offices, public spaces like cinemas, and neighborhood necessities like stores and schools. As per the present proposal, 100,000 individuals will work there and 35,000 individuals will live there full-time. The design, which was first presented in 1989, also calls for novel trains to service each space plateau, as well as triple-decked, fast elevators.
